Dimensions & Key Features
- Total Heated Area: ~2,400 sq ft 26
- Bedrooms: 3 27
- Bathrooms: 2 full + 1 half 28
- Stories: Single level 29
- Porch & Patio Areas: ~840 sq ft combined 30
- Width: ~60′ 31
- Depth: ~40′ 32
- Ceiling Heights: ~12 ft in main areas 33

Estimated U.S. Build Cost (USD)
Assuming typical U.S. construction costs of around **$140–$220 per sq ft** for barndominium-style builds, constructing this ~2,400 sq ft plan could range between **$336,000 and $528,000 USD** (excluding land, permits, and site preparation). 35
